## Runbook: Pickwise optimizer stalls

If the Pickwise pick-list optimizer stops emitting batches, first check the route-solver queue depth — over 2k usually means a stuck solver worker. Bounce the worker pool, not the whole service (warehouses hate cold starts). If it stalls again within an hour, escalate to the Granary team. Step-by-step recovery details are on this page.

runbook for badug-kadup: https://confluence.zemvarlabs.internal/projects/browse/display/projects/bd1b

## Deployment

The Quillmoth sidecar rides along every pod in the metrics tier and flushes aggregates every 15 seconds. You don't need to build it yourself — the release job publishes a pinned image, and the deploy script wires it into the pod spec automatically. If a flush stalls, restart just the sidecar, not the main container. For reference while you're on call, the active config is as follows.

settings of tagef-bawif:
DRUIX_HOST=druix.zemvarlabs.internal
DRUIX_PORT=8000

Subject: Remindrel cut-over summary for weekly sync

Team — the Remindrel appointment reminder job for the Oakmere Clinic group completed its cut-over to the new scheduler on Tuesday night. All pending reminders were drained from the legacy queue first, verified by row counts on both sides. SMS and voice channels were tested against the staging clinic roster before flipping traffic. No duplicate reminders were observed in the 48-hour watch window. The job now runs with the following configuration values.

service settings:
[casax]
port = 6379
team = rusir
host = casax.zemvarhq.corp
region = outer-4
access_code = ac_9808ce
timeout_ms = 1500

// Prefetcher constants for the Wrenmoor tile service.
// Support team: if customers report blank tiles while panning,
// the prefetcher ring is likely too small for their zoom pattern,
// not a renderer bug. The prefetcher speculatively fetches a ring
// of tiles around the viewport, bounded by concurrency and cache
// limits to avoid starving live requests. The effective limits
// currently shipped are the constants that follow.

tuning constants:
QUOTAS = {
    "druwyn": 5,
    "holix": 5,
    "zorath": 5,
    "holwyn": 10,
}